Understanding Clogged Gutters: Prevention, Consequences, and SolutionsIntro
Clogged gutters might seem like a minor hassle, however they can cause significant problems for house owners if left uncontrolled. Gutter systems play an essential role in directing rainwater away from a home's foundation, siding, and roof. When these systems end up being clogged, they can overflow, leading to water damage, mold development, and even structural issues. This short article looks into the causes, repercussions, avoidance techniques, and solutions for clogged gutters, gearing up property owners with the understanding to maintain their gutter systems effectively.
What Causes Clogged Gutters?
Comprehending what adds to clogged gutters is essential for reliable prevention. Frequent culprits include:
Leaves and Debris: When leaves, twigs, and pine needles fall from trees, they can build up in gutters, especially during the fall season.Animals: Birds and small animals may develop nests in gutters, blocking water flow.Dirt and Soil: Wind and rain can wash soil and dirt into gutters, resulting in obstructions.Roof Debris: Shingle granules, moss, and algae can break off from the roof and collect in gutters.Improper Slope: If gutters do not have a correct slope, water may not stream easily, causing stagnancy and blocking.Repercussions of Clogged Gutters
The presence of clogged gutters can result in a series of regrettable consequences that impact both the exterior and interior of a home. A few of these include:
ConsequencesDescriptionWater DamageWhen water overruns from clogged gutters, it can leak into walls, ceilings, and foundations, causing pricey repairs.Mold and Mildew GrowthStagnant water produces a perfect environment for mold and mildew, which can affect indoor air quality and health.Foundation IssuesExcess water pooling around the structure can cause cracks and instability, potentially leading to more extreme structural damage.Insect InfestationClogged gutters can attract insects like mosquitoes and rodents, which may find ideal nesting environments.Roof DamageWater pooling on the roof can lead to leaks and structural wear and tear over time.Avoidance Strategies for Clogged Gutters
Awareness and proactive procedures can significantly decrease the threat of clogged gutters. Here are some efficient methods:
Regular Cleaning: Aim to clean gutters at least two times a year, normally in the spring and fall, to eliminate leaves and debris.Set Up Gutter Guards: Gutter guards are protective covers that avoid debris from entering the gutters while enabling water to flow through.Trim Nearby Trees: Regularly trim tree branches that hang over or near gutters to decrease the amount of falling particles.Check and Maintain: Regular inspections of the gutter system can recognize concerns like sagging or inappropriate slope that may lead to blockages.Consider Downspout Extensions: Downspout extensions can direct water even more away from the foundation, avoiding pooling.Look for Nesting: Periodically take a look at gutters for indications of bird or animal nests and remove them quickly.Cleaning and Maintaining Clogged Gutters
Cleaning clogged gutters may seem laborious, however doing it successfully can avoid more serious concerns down the line. Here follows a detailed guide:
Gather Tools: Essential tools consist of gloves, a trowel, a bucket, a garden pipe, and a ladder.Safety First: Ensure that the ladder is stable and located on even ground. If necessary, have somebody help you.Eliminate Debris: Use gloves and a trowel to scoop out particles, placing it in a container for simple disposal.Flush with Water: Once the debris is removed, utilize a garden hose pipe to flush the gutters, ensuring water flows freely to the downspouts.Inspect Downspouts: If water does not drain pipes appropriately from the downspouts, utilize a plumbing technician's snake or comparable tool to clear any potential blockages.Make Repairs: Look for signs of damage, such as leakages or drooping, and make necessary repairs promptly.FAQs About Clogged Gutters
How frequently should gutters be cleaned up?
It is advised to tidy gutters at least two times a year, with extra cleansings as needed, especially in leafy locations or before storms.
What can I do if I can not clean my gutters myself?
Lots of business specialize in gutter cleaning company. Employing a professional may be rewarding for those uncomfortable with heights or physical labor.
Are gutter guards worth it?
Gutter guards can considerably minimize the quantity of debris that gets in gutters, making maintenance efforts simpler and less regular.
What is the very best time to tidy gutters?
The very best times to clean gutters are usually in the spring after pollen falls and in the fall after leaves have dropped.
What should I do if I see standing water in my gutters?
Standing water often indicates a blockage. It's important to clean up the gutter or seek professional aid if required instantly.
